Mastering the Craft: Effective Prompt Engineering

The quality of ChatGPT content creation depends entirely on the quality of your instructions. Vague prompts produce vague results. Specific, well-crafted prompts that include context, a desired format, and clear constraints produce usable content.

A well-engineered prompt includes clear instructions, context, input data, a desired output format, and constraints. For example, instead of asking, “Write about email marketing,” a better prompt is: “Act as a B2B marketing consultant. Write a 500-word blog post for small business owners explaining why segmented email campaigns are effective. Use a friendly, encouraging tone.” This specificity dramatically improves the output.

Role-playing is a powerful technique. Instructing ChatGPT to “Act as a [specific role]” tells it which perspective to use. Setting constraints like word count or a specific number of examples also forces the AI to be more precise and focused.

Iterative refinement is key. Your first prompt rarely yields a perfect result. Treat it as a conversation: review the output and ask for specific changes, like adjusting the tone or adding an example. Each iteration brings you closer to the desired content.

The research shows that specificity matters. Being too vague, asking leading questions, or cramming too many instructions into one prompt typically produces disappointing results. On the flip side, providing context—like your target audience, desired tone, and the purpose of the content—dramatically improves output quality. [LIST] of 5 essential prompt formulas for marketers

  1. Role-Playing + Task: “Act as a seasoned [industry] content strategist. Generate 5 blog post ideas about [topic] that would appeal to [target audience], focusing on [specific benefit/problem].”
  2. Context + Change: “Given the following [type of content, e.g., blog post text]: ‘[paste text here]’. Summarize this content into a 150-character social media caption for [platform, e.g., X/Twitter], including 2 relevant hashtags.”
  3. Iterative Refinement: “Rewrite the previous response to be more [tone, e.g., humorous/professional/concise] and include a call-to-action to [action, e.g., ‘Learn more on our blog’].”
  4. Constraint-Based Generation: “Write a meta description for a webpage about [product/service] with a maximum of 160 characters. Include the keyword ‘[primary keyword]’ and emphasize [unique selling proposition].”
  5. Few-Shot Example + New Generation: “Here are three examples of engaging email subject lines for a product launch: [Example 1], [Example 2], [Example 3]. Generate 5 new subject lines for an email announcing our new [product name] in a similar style.”

ChatGPT content creation has significant limitations. Treating it as a flawless tool is a recipe for disaster.

A magnifying glass hovering over AI-generated text, highlighting a factual error within the text. - ChatGPT content creation

Key pitfalls include:

  • AI Hallucinations: The model can confidently state completely fabricated “facts,” wrecking your credibility.
  • Knowledge Cutoff: Its training data has a cutoff date, so it’s unaware of recent events or developments.
  • Inherent Bias: AI models inherit biases from their training data, which can lead to problematic content if not carefully reviewed.

Understanding ‘Constructed’ vs. ‘Created’ Content

A crucial distinction is between ‘constructed’ and ‘created’ content.

  • Constructed content is information compiled from existing sources, which is what AI produces. It’s useful for summarizing and structuring information.
  • Created content is thought leadership born from lived experience, unique perspective, and hard-won expertise. This is what builds authority and connection.

ChatGPT excels at constructed content but cannot replicate created content. It has never launched a campaign or felt the panic of a failed ad. As content expert Robert Rose explains this distinction, the authenticity and credibility must come from you.

Ethical Considerations and Google’s Stance

Plagiarism is a major ethical concern. One study found that nearly 60% of ChatGPT output contains plagiarized text. Publishing raw AI output risks your reputation and intellectual property rights. The solution is responsible use: every piece requires human review, fact-checking, and significant refinement to ensure originality and value.

Google’s stance is nuanced. According to their official guidance on AI content, they don’t penalize content for using AI. They penalize low-value, unoriginal content created to manipulate search rankings, regardless of the author. Google’s focus remains on E-E-A-T (Experience, Expertise, Authoritativeness, Trustworthiness), qualities that AI alone cannot demonstrate.

The winning formula combines AI’s efficiency with human expertise. Use AI for drafts, but always add your unique insights, verify facts, and provide an authentic perspective. This human-AI collaboration is critical in the evolving search landscape, including developments like The Impact of AI Overviews. The bottom line: treat AI as an assistant, not a replacement. Transparency and fact-checking are essential for creating content that ranks.

SEO and ChatGPT Content Creation: A Powerful Duo

ChatGPT is a powerful partner for SEO, handling time-consuming tasks with efficiency. It accelerates keyword research, generating lists of long-tail and LSI keywords with their search intent. It can quickly draft multiple meta descriptions and title tags within character limits. For existing content, it helps with FAQ generation to target “People Also Ask” sections and identifies internal linking opportunities to strengthen site architecture. Repurposing Content for Maximum Reach

Repurposing content for maximum reach is where ChatGPT content creation truly pays dividends. It’s about strategic adaptation, not just copy-pasting. A single blog post can be transformed into:

  • A threaded social post for X (Twitter) or LinkedIn.
  • An email series diving into specific aspects of the topic.
  • A readable article from a video transcript, or vice-versa.
  • Punchy snippets and quotes for visual platforms.

Successful cross-platform adaptation requires adjusting the tone, length, and format for each channel’s audience expectations. ChatGPT can make these adjustments efficiently, ensuring your core message reaches a wider audience across their preferred platforms and maximizing the ROI of your original content.
